Quick Margherita Naan Pizza (Printable)

A flavorful twist featuring naan flatbread, fresh mozzarella, tomatoes, and fragrant basil leaves.

# Components:

→ Base

01 - 2 large plain or garlic naan breads

→ Sauce

02 - ½ cup tomato passata or pizza sauce
03 - ½ teaspoon dried oregano
04 - ¼ teaspoon sea salt
05 - ¼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

→ Toppings

06 - 4.5 oz fresh mozzarella, sliced
07 - 1 medium ripe tomato, thinly sliced
08 - 8 to 10 fresh basil leaves
09 - 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il

# Directions:

01 - Preheat oven to 425°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
02 - Arrange naan breads on the prepared baking sheet.
03 - Combine tomato passata with dried oregano, sea salt, and black pepper in a small bowl.
04 - Spread sauce evenly over each naan, leaving a small border around the edges.
05 - Top each naan with sliced mozzarella and tomato, distributing evenly.
06 - Bake for 8 to 10 minutes until cheese bubbles and naan edges turn golden.
07 - Remove from oven, drizzle with olive oil, scatter fresh basil leaves on top, slice, and serve immediately.

02 -
  • Do not use pre shredded mozzarella because it has anti caking powder on it and will not melt right.
  • If your tomato is watery, pat the slices dry with a paper towel before putting them on the naan.
  • The naan will puff up a little in the oven, which is normal and actually kind of fun to watch.
03 -
  • If you want the naan extra crispy, toast it in the oven for 2 minutes before adding the sauce.
  • Use a pizza cutter to slice it instead of a knife, it is faster and you will not drag all the toppings off.
  • Double the recipe and freeze the baked pizzas, then reheat them straight from frozen when you need dinner in a hurry.
